The American dream and contemporary Hollywood cinema

While the myth of a classless America endures in the American Dream, the very stratification that it denies unfairly affects the majority of Americans. Study after study shows that it's increasingly difficult for working class people to achieve upward mobility in the US - so how does the American Dream continue to thrive?. J. Emmett Winn€shows us€that the American Dream's continued glorification in contemporary Hollywood cinema should not be ignored.
